Warning Signs You Need Black Water Extraction (Category 3)

With black water extraction, early detection is key in preventing further damage and ensuring a safe environment. Here are some war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of black water and bacteria.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it’s essential to call for professional help.

Water Stains and Warping

Water stains and warping on walls, floors, and ceilings can show water damage and the potential for black water contamination. Don’t ignore these signs, call us today to schedule an inspection.

Discoloration and Slime

Discoloration and slime on surfaces can show the presence of bacteria and other contaminants.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Musty Smells in Air Ducts

Musty smells in air ducts can show the presence of black water and bacteria. Call us today to schedule an inspection and ensure a safe environment for you and your family.

Unexplained Health Issues

Unexplained health issues such as respiratory problems, skin irritation, and gastrointestinal issues can be linked to black water contamination. If you’re experiencing these symptoms, it’s essential to seek professional help.

Black Water Extraction (Category 3) v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 10 gallons) Yes No Easy to clean up and contain.
Category 3 water contamination (black water) No Yes Needs specialized equipment and training to handle safely.
Structural damage to walls or floors No Yes Needs professional assessment and repair to prevent further damage.
Unpleasant odors and musty smells No Yes Shows potential health risks and needs professional cleaning and sanitizing.
Water damage to electrical systems No Yes Needs professional assessment and repair to prevent electrical shock and fires.
Large water spill (more than 100 gallons) No Yes Needs specialized equipment and training to contain and clean up safely.

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cost in Gulf Stream, FL

The cost of black water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Gulf Stream, FL. Here’s a breakdown of the typical costs associated with this service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Arrival and Assessment $100 – $500 Severity of damage, distance from our location
Containment $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of materials involved
Extraction $1,000 – $5,000 Amount of water, type of equipment required
Sanitizing and Restoration $1,500 – $6,000 Size of affected area, type of materials involved
More Services (e.g., mold remediation, drywall repair) $500 – $2,000 Severity of damage, type of materials involved

Keep in mind that these estimates are based on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will provide a more accurate estimate after conducting an on-site assessment. Q: What is black water, and why is it a concern?

Black water is a type of water that is contaminated with Category 3 pathogens, including b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ms. It’s a concern because it can pose a risk to your health and safety, and it needs specialized cleaning and sanitizing to prevent the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ms.
